字符之海
两千粒字符在 Perlin Noise 流场中漂流,像一片有生命的海洋。鼠标是引力的锚点,字符围绕它旋转、聚散、拖出光尾。五种配色在冷暖之间切换-每一帧都是一幅稍纵即逝的字符画。
关于作品
《字符之海》是「字码世界」三部曲的第一章。在这里,等宽字符脱离了它们作为代码符号的本职,化身为流体中的微粒。Simplex Noise 算法生成一个实时演变的二维矢量场,每一粒字符被场力推动前行,速度决定字符的选择-静止时显示密实的 '@'、'#',高速时变为纤细的 '·'、':'。鼠标成为这片字符海洋中的一个引力/斥力奇点:按住左键吸引,按住右键排斥,拖曳时带起一片光尾。五种配色(极光绿、深海蓝、赛博红、日落橙、矩阵金)让同一片海洋呈现截然不同的情绪。控制面板可调整粒子数、流速和字号,在性能与视觉密度之间找到平衡。
功能介绍
- Simplex Noise 二维流场驱动 2000+ 字符粒子
- 速度→字符密度映射(快=稀,慢=密)
- 鼠标引力/斥力交互 + 光尾拖曳
- 五种配色方案实时切换
- 粒子数/流速/字号可调控制面板
- 120 FPS 流畅渲染
使用说明
- 页面自动启动字符粒子动画
- 移动鼠标影响粒子运动轨迹
- 按住左键吸引字符、右键排斥字符
- 使用右下角面板切换配色和调整参数
- 点击全屏按钮进入沉浸模式